#1160ad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1160ad is composed of 6.7% red, 37.6%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.2% cyan, 44.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 209.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 37.3%. #1160ad color hex could be obtained by blending #22c0ff with #00005b.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#1160ad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01070c is the darkest color, while #f9f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1160ad

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5f64 is the less saturated color, while #0260bc is the most saturated one.
